📖 Bible Verse

“But God has shown us how much He loves us - it was while we were still sinners that Christ died for us! - Romans 5:8.

🕊️ Story / Reflection

God loves you. This is one of the most important things you will ever know.

Before you could run, read, or even talk, God already loved you. 

His love does not depend on how good you are or how well you behave.

 God loves you because you are His.

When you wake up in the morning, God loves you. When you go to school, God loves you. When you make mistakes or feel sad, God still loves you. God’s love is always with you.

God loves you very much. His love is big, strong, and never-ending. There is nothing you can do to make God love you more, and nothing you can do to make Him love you less.

God’s love is with you when you are happy, when you make mistakes, and even when you feel sad or afraid. He loved us so much that He sent Jesus to show us His love in a way we could understand.

When we remember God’s love, our hearts feel safe, joyful, and full of peace.
